Chet Tanaka Interview Transcript (ddr-densho-1007-1869)
doc Chet Tanaka Interview Transcript (ddr-densho-1007-1869)
Eric Saul interview with Chet Tanaka, veteran of the 442nd Regimental Combat team, conducted on October 8, 1980. Tanaka describes his childhood in St. Louis, Missouri, his family's experience with discrimination after Pearl Harbor, his reaction to forced removal on Japanese Americans, and his military service during World War II.
Bombing of Pearl Harbor (ddr-densho-37-769)
img Bombing of Pearl Harbor (ddr-densho-37-769)
Original caption: Naval photograph documenting the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or, Hawaii which initiated US participation in World War II. Navy's caption: Colors flying from USS WEST VIRGINIA(left) and USS ARIZONA (right) aflame, after the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or of Dec. 7, 1941., 12/07/1941
